Things to do in Largo?
Largo, Florida lies just outside Tampa Bay and provides easy access to the local beaches as well as natural attractions such as Eagle Lake Park or The Armed Forces History Museum for history enthusiasts.

Things to do in New Wilmington?
New Wilmington, Pennsylvania is a small town with a population of less than 3,000 people. It provides a quaint atmosphere and offers residents the opportunity to experience a quiet, laid-back lifestyle. With numerous parks, local businesses, churches, and community events happening often, there is always something to do in this charming little town. Residents enjoy the easy access to nearby larger cities while also benefiting from the tight-knit community that comes with living in such a small place. New Wilmington offers some of the best of both worlds for those looking for an escape from fast-paced city life and still maintain access to amenities found elsewhere.
